Understanding Factors Affecting Hours
Several factors can influence Nova Credit Union’s operating hours. Being aware of these can help you plan your visits more effectively and avoid any surprises.
Holidays
Holidays are one of the most common reasons for changes in operating hours. Most credit unions observe federal holidays, which may result in closures or reduced hours. Common holidays that affect credit union hours include:
Always check the holiday schedule on Nova Credit Union's website or contact customer service to confirm their hours during holidays.
Special Events
Occasionally, special events can also impact the hours of operation. These might include:
Unexpected Circumstances
Unexpected circumstances such as inclement weather or emergencies can also lead to temporary closures or reduced hours. For example:
Stay informed by checking the credit union's website or app for any announcements regarding unexpected closures.
